I assume that you mean the ea82 from an l series (not the ejxx series from impreza, liberty and forester)
Does your motor have a Carburettor, Fuel Injection or a Turbo?
There is little to no point in putting a pod filter on a carby motor. Other than ricer looks and louder induction noise. The stock air filter probably flows more air than the pod.
On MPFI and turbo models, i doubt there would be much different either as the intake pipes are more restrictive than the pannel air filter.
You can do it, others have done it, even i was gonna do it at one stage. But the benifits are minimal
